An Alternative Route For Manufacture Of Diammonium Phosphate

The present study was undertaken with the aim of producing Diammonium Phosphate (DAP) using air as a source of nitrogen and bones a source of phosphoric acid. Oxygen was removed from air by passing air over heated copper granules in the temperature range of 300oC – 500oC. Copper granules were heated using charcoal packed in a ceramic charcoal stove. Assessment Of The Levels Of Thiocyanate In Processed And Unprocessed Red And Brown Finger Millet ( Eleusine Coracana) Grown In Mogotio Area, Baringo County, Kenya

Finger millet (Eleusine coracana) is an important African staple food crop in the tropics. The crop contains cyanogenic glycosides which can be readily converted to thiocyanate by glycosidases and sulfur transferase enzymes present in the plant or in the animal tissues. Thiocyanate inhibits the uptake of iodine by the iodide pump of the thyroid gland thus acting as a goitrogen which suppresses thyroid function leading to goiter.
